GRANTS to help improve shop fronts in Frankston are open now.

The Invest Frankston facade improvement and vacant shop front grants are accepting applications.

Grants of up to $20,000 matched dollar for dollar are available through the façade improvement grant. The money can be used for greenery, repainting, signage works, street frontage changes, weather protection, or for items to accommodate night trading. Up to $20,000 is available from the vacant shopfront grants to help prospective business owners looking to sign a lease in the Frankston municipality set up their business space.
